Ticket: Staging env misconfigured for Siftgate bloom filter

The bloom layer in front of the Pellet KV store is rejecting all lookups in staging because the env file was copied from the dev template without credentials. False-positive tuning values are fine; only the auth line is missing. To unblock the weekly demo, the Pellet admission secret must be set on the following line.

env line for yaguf-fajop: LEDGER_TOKEN13=fb08984397349

**Minutes — Commission Scheme Revision**

Prepared for the Caldmere Group board. The committee approved the revised sales-commission scheme, replacing flat-rate payouts with tiered accelerators tied to margin rather than volume. Transition begins next quarter with a two-month parallel run. Payroll impacts were reviewed and deemed manageable. The confidential note on related plans appears below.

board note of hahaf-bajog: Only 12 of the 380 pilot accounts renewed Rusath, so a churn review is set for December 17. Fenysek Freight is in early talks to buy Tamvanax Group for about $41.8 million.

# FlagLeap — Build Provenance (support crib sheet)

Hey support folks — quick rundown on how FlagLeap builds get made, so you can answer "which version am I on?" tickets. Every rollout-framework release comes out of the Tolliver pipeline, gets signed automatically, and lands in the artifact shelf with a full provenance record. If a customer reports weird flag behavior, grab their version string and match it against the shelf. Nothing ships outside the pipeline, ever. Each release's trace token sits right under this paragraph.

build token for tahop-fafof: htk14_2d55df8101eccc

### Step 3: Apply the patched cache settings

The memory leak in PicVault's image cache stemmed from evicted entries retaining decoded buffers. The patched release bounds buffer lifetime and enforces a hard cap on resident memory, which also limits exposure from oversized crafted images. Please confirm the limits below match your threat-model assumptions. The patched cache configuration is as follows.

deployment values, yahag-tawef:
ZORWYN_HOST=zorwyn.tolvaqlabs.internal
ZORWYN_PORT=9300